It's crap!

As someone who has to listen to music and produce it, I actually like a boggo standard system to get a sense of the real world for production and mixes but this stereo is very poor in the volume department.

As soon as I turn it up and the loud bits kick in the volume drops right away. Seems to be some sort of digital limiting to stop the amp clipping and sending a clipped signal to the speakers.

The rear speakers may as well not exist either.

I didn't think it would be great but not this bad. I honestly thought it would at least be something half decent. As I say I like a fairly standard set up for the already mentioned reasons but even my wifes old Micra had a better sound set up and the standard system in my cheaply made Celica was vastly superior.

I feel a bit short changed on this to be honest. Though my wifes new
Msport badge nonsense 1 series has a rather poor stereo as well. Seems to be a BMW cost exercise and a way of selling extra kit.
